Janelle Rodriguez is a native Californian and has been performing as a dancer since the age of 5. Janelle’s early background in dance includes jazz, tap, ballet, modern dance, gymnastics, and Mexican Folklore. In 1995, she decided to explore foreign dance territory by experiencing the exotic and mysterious Middle Eastern bellydance.Visit Janelle's website at www.janelledance.com

Nathalia is a native of beautiful Colombia where she grew up dancing to an array of Latin beats with a variety of moves! In her twenty years of dancing experience, she has won several dance contests in her native country and choreographed several dance groups. She believes in the positive effects that music exudes and the passion it releases, and dance is her chosen method of portraying her zest for life! Now she is opening the doors to her chosen art: Zumba… a fun workout that blends Latin rhythms with fun aerobic movements, many of which were originally crafted in tropical Colombia!

Marisa Herzog/Raks Baraka
Marisa has been belly dancing for over 12 years. An alum of Rossah's Hand of Fatima Dance Tribe, she combines ethnic sensibilities with the inspiration of the Silk Road for a unique folk-fusion style. She dances and teaches with her troupe, Raks Baraka (which roughly means "blessed dance").

| Linda Adams RN, LAc has studied and been a practitioner of traditional energetic healing arts and Taoist Yoga for over 26 years. She has had the unique privilege of training with Masters from China, Vietnam, Korea, Japan and Thailand, which has given her a rich background in the fields of Eastern Energetic Movement and Healing. She teaches and has a private practice in Santa Cruz, CA and is committed to sharing her deep understanding of universal energy systems for the pleasure, benefit and deep inner healing of all |

Qi Gong: This class explores developing a graceful flow of movement through our bodies by opening them in such a way that ultimately it is our breath and our qi that move us. As our bodies relax the qi and blood circulate more fully the inner transformation of our physical bodies, our emotional states and our spiritual body can all happen more easily.
